VER03MPG -Proportional Relief Valve

Description
Continental Hydraulics VER03MPG pilot operated proportional relief valves conform to NFPA R03 / D03 and ISO 6264:1998 mounting standards.

The VER03MPG valves have integral electronics on-board to maximize the valve’s performance. They are designed to modulate pressure in a hydraulic circuit directly proportional to the input command signal to the valve.

Command signals available are 0 -10 VDC and 4 – 20 mA.

The valve consists of a proportional pilot relief stage with on-board electronics and a main relief stage.The main stage has a spool which is held closed by a spring. System pressure acts on the opposite end of the spool opposing the spring force. When system pressure exceeds the spring force, the valve begins to open. The spring preload sets the minimum controlled pressure.

System pressure can be increased from minimum by increasing the pilot pressure which adds to the spring force. The spool will tend to close until the system pressure reaches its new setting.

There are four pressure ranges available: 70 bar, 140 bar, 210 bar and 350 bar with flow up to 13.2 gpm.

It is an internally piloted valve with three drain options – internal through T port, external through A port and external through Y port.
